Frequently Asked Questions

How does my child perform on timed practice tests compared to untimed ones?
Significant differences may indicate issues with speed and accuracy, a crucial aspect of P4 Math.
Can my child explain the why behind math concepts, not just how to solve them?
Explaining the why demonstrates a deeper understanding, essential for tackling complex problem sums.
How consistently can my child apply model drawing techniques to solve word problems?
Consistent and accurate model drawing indicates a strong grasp of problem-solving strategies.
Is my child able to identify the correct heuristics (problem-solving shortcuts) to use in different situations?
Correctly identifying and applying heuristics shows strategic thinking and efficient problem-solving.
How well does my child retain information from previous topics and apply it to new ones?
Strong retention and application of prior knowledge are crucial for building a solid foundation.
How often does my child make careless mistakes, and what types of errors are most common?
Tracking careless errors helps identify areas needing more focus and attention to detail.
Does my child actively participate in class and ask questions when they dont understand something?
Active participation indicates engagement and a willingness to clarify doubts, promoting better understanding.
How does my childs performance compare to the class average or benchmark scores?
Comparing performance provides context and helps identify areas where your child may need extra support.
Can my child solve challenging word problems independently, or do they always require assistance?
Independence in problem-solving demonstrates confidence and a strong understanding of the concepts.
